JavaScript实现计数器基础方法
这篇文章主要介绍了如何使用JavaScript实现一个简单计数器的基础方法。通过计时事件来实现计数的功能,使用setInterval和setTimeout两个方法,可以轻松实现计时功能。下面是一个简单的HTML页面示例,展示了如何使用JavaScript实现计数器的功能。
在这个例子中,我们首先定义了两个变量c和t,其中c用来记录计数值,t用来保存计时器的ID。然后定义了一个timedCount函数,用于更新计数器的值,并将其显示在文本框中。每隔一定的时间(这里是每隔一秒钟),就会调用这个函数来更新计数器的值。我们还定义了一个sCount函数,用于清除计时器。
在HTML页面中,我们使用了三个按钮和一个文本框来实现计数器的功能。点击开始按钮后,调用timedCount函数开始计时;点击停止按钮后,调用sCount函数停止计时;文本框中显示当前的计数值。需要注意的是,这个计数器有一个小bug,即当多次点击开始按钮时,计数的速度会增加,而且点击一次停止按钮并不能立即停止计时,需要多次点击才能停止。这个问题可以通过改进代码来解决。同时也可以通过美化页面、增加交互等方式来提升用户体验。还可以根据实际需求添加更多功能,比如限制计数范围、显示时间等。在实际应用中,还需要考虑代码的可读性、可维护性和可扩展性等问题。同时还需要注意一些安全问题,比如防止恶意攻击等。总之通过学习和实践JavaScript可以实现很多有趣的功能包括计数器在内让我们不断和学习吧!以上是这段代码的介绍和希望能对大家有所帮助。在编程的过程中也需要不断地实践和才能不断进步哦!喜欢这个示例的话不妨试试看能否加入更多有趣的功能让计数器变得更加实用和有趣吧!
编程语言
- JavaScript实现计数器基础方法
- jQuery实现可展开折叠的导航效果示例
- CheckBox多选取值及判断CheckBox选中是否为空的实例
- JavaScript数组随机排列实现随机洗牌功能
- 浅谈mysql数据库中的换行符与textarea中的换行符
- php 猴子摘桃的算法
- Javascript Validation for email(正则表达式) 英文翻译
- CodeIgniter使用smtp服务发送html邮件的方法
- 简述JavaScript的正则表达式中test()方法的使用
- 解决angular双向绑定无效果,ng-model不能正常显示的
- 把多个JavaScript函数绑定到onload事件处理函数上的
- jquery判断复选框是否被选中的方法
- JavaScript实现提交模式窗口后刷新父窗口数据的方
- JS清除文本框内容离开在恢复及鼠标离开文本框时
- php 批量查询搜狗sogou代码分享
- ajax 不错的应用